Apple Resolves Siri Eavesdropping Class-Action Suit, Initiates $95 Million Compensation Distribution to U.S. Users

Apple has successfully settled a class-action lawsuit concerning the "unauthorized and deliberate recording" by Siri, and has been rolling out compensation to qualifying users since mid-last year. The legal action was initiated in 2019. While Apple initially refuted any misconduct and subsequently bolstered Siri's privacy safeguards, the tech giant ultimately opted to settle. To be eligible for compensation, users must have bought Apple devices that support Siri between September 17, 2014, and December 31, 2024, and encountered the issue of "Siri activating unexpectedly." Each user is entitled to claim compensation for a maximum of five devices, with the total compensation fund amounting to $95 million. It is projected that each device will receive roughly $8.02, with a maximum individual compensation of around $40.1. At present, certain users have already received their compensation payments.
